Output 75fc602ecf034d8977739d1a2b7f15d70f4ffdb4a7ee84a2eaa6d832abbd62ef:0

value
633536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 520e276318724b49342222531d76f7627931d3cdcc42ffb5cfadb9a3ae8ee731
address
bc1p2g8zwcccwf95jdpzyff36ahhvfunr57de3p0ldw04ku68t5wuucsfc3zl4
transaction
75fc602ecf034d8977739d1a2b7f15d70f4ffdb4a7ee84a2eaa6d832abbd62ef
confirmations
22678
spent
true